Usage Information
If the maximum IPv6 route limit is not specied for a VRF (valid range is from 1 to 8000), then it has
unlimited space that extends to the maximum number of entries allowed for the system. This command is
not applicable to the default and management VRFs.
ipv6 address autocong
Congure IPv6 address auto-conguration for the management interface.
Syntax
ipv6 address autoconfig
To disable the address autocong operation on the management interface, use the no ipv6 address
autoconfig command.
Default Disabled
Command Modes INTERFACE (management interface only)

Usage Infomation
SAA can congure up to two addresses. If any preferred prex or valid timers time out, the
corresponding address are deprecated or removed. If an address is removed due to a time-out, an
address from the current unused prex is used to create a new address. If there are no remaining
prexes, the software waits to receive a new prex from the RA.
